Transaction 341c10abee056ba2c0878f7ba5843710c047f83ae109ec8833408cc5fcf9ab52
1 Input
2 Outputs
- 341c10abee056ba2c0878f7ba5843710c047f83ae109ec8833408cc5fcf9ab52:0
- 341c10abee056ba2c0878f7ba5843710c047f83ae109ec8833408cc5fcf9ab52:1
value 781700
address 3MPHkkJ3tV7RFEy3edSHJthridT1SgsFkT
value 905801
address 17mPqxa5n1Z1anCqBJbTKTYR6iwULm641n